How to Buy, Sell, and Bid on World of Warcraft Auction Houses

The auction house is the central core of the World of Warcraft economy, as lucrative as the auction house is, it’s also a bit confusing at first. This WoW Auction House Guide will demonstrate how to get started on the auction house, as well as the best buy price and best sell price for items.

Where to find auction houses?

Auction houses can be located in cities and some of the towns found throughout Azeroth. If you are playing for the Alliance, auction houses can be located in the following cities; Stormwind, Darnassus, Ironforge, and Exodar. If you play for the Horde side, auction houses can be located in the Undercity, Ogrimmar, Thunder Bluff, and Silvermoon City.

Use of the auction house

The first thing to do once you reach an AH is to talk to the auctioneer, just click on the character to start. On the left of the dialog window, you’ll notice that there are categories for the items listed, for example; weaponry and armor. Simply clicking on the category you wish to browse will open a new dialog window where you can browse the items on offer on the auction house.

filters

It’s worth getting familiar with filters as soon as possible, as this can save a ton of time! There are many items available in the AH and if you don’t apply filters and get more specific, you could be browsing there for hours! To apply a filter, simply click on the “All” tab and apply your filters from there.

If you happen to know the name of the item you’re trying to purchase, you can go ahead and mark it in the search filter, then click search and see if they have the item you need right away (make sure you spell the item name correctly!) .

A good tip for fashion fans is that you can see how an item will look on your character before you commit to buying it! This is commonly known as the dressing room, to do this hold CTRL and then click on the item you wish to equip to preview your character.

price check

Before you fully commit to buying any item, make sure you know the price first! If you found the item was good value for money and wanted it right there, you could “buy” it at the asking price. To do this, select the item you wish to purchase and then click the “buy” tab at the bottom of the AH window.

Bid on an item

The auction house is no different than a real world auction house (in theory), if you decide to bid on an item you can expect other players to bid as well. You should definitely start bidding as soon as the auction starts, just in case you can come away clean without competition (highly unlikely, but you never know).

To bid on an item, click on the bid tab located near the “buy” tab. Please note that when you bid on a certain item, the amount of gold you bid will be automatically deducted from your funds. If another player outbids you, the deducted gold will be returned to you by post. Check your mailbox!

Sell ​​on the auction house

Selling items on the auction house is a bit more complex than bidding on items, but it’s still pretty easy once you’ve done it a few times. If you want to earn more gold in WoW, auction houses are a safe bet. To start selling an item in the AH, you will need to select the “Auctions” tab located on the left of the screen and then place the item you wish to sell on the vacant item slot.

You will need to set a starting price and a full purchase price for your item. Make sure you know the monetary value of your items before you put them up for sale at auction. The best way here, if you’re not sure, is to search for the same item in the auction and set your starting and purchase price slightly lower than theirs. Then you’ll want to select the duration of your auction item in 12 hours, 24 hours. hours or 48 hours.

So BINGO, if your item was successfully sold, you will receive an email with your payment of WoW gold waiting inside, ready to be cashed out.
